India-Pakistan
Special branch had marked Qadri as risk for VVIP security
2011-01-06
[Dawn] The Rawalpindi Special Branch had earlier marked Salman Taseer's assassin Mumtaz Hussain Qadri and 10 other security personnel as a risk for VVIP movement, DawnNews reported.

Special Branch official Nasir Khan Durrani had marked the 11 security personnel a risk for VVIP security due to their leanings toward religious extremism.

Moreover, another three personnel of the Elite Force were jugged from Rawalpindi in connection with Taseer's liquidation.

Investigations were ongoing as to why Mumtaz Qadri was appointed for Taseer's security.
